Best Fitness Classes In DFW

Dallas and Fort Worth have become the site of Texas' most plentiful fitness centers. However, just because a class or gym is close to home or offering great prices, doesn't mean they can whip you into shape, not to mention keep you interested and motivated in the long term. Looking for a fitness class that keeps you moving, shaking and burning those calories? Drop those exercise videos and try one of these non-stop, action-packed fitness classes.

Title Boxing Club
5001 S. Cooper St., Suite 103
Arlington, TX 76017
(817) 200-4143
arlington-cooperstreet.titleboxingclub.comTitle Boxing Club offers a variety of tough classes designed to get you into shape and make you a formidable opponent of life's biggest challenges. It has kickboxing and boxing classes that focus on strength, technique and stamina. Boxing class will take you through a well-designed course of running, push-ups, jumping jacks, crunches, punches, kicks, uppercuts and more. Do not expect any downtime at Title Boxing Club. Best yet, the first class is free at many locations. All you need is a set of wraps!
Vertical Fitness
6090 Campbell Road #136
Dallas, TX 75248
(972) 679-1020
www.verticalfitnessdallas.comVertical Fitness opens the mind to new fitness possibilities with aerial silks classes, aerial hoops classes and even aerial yoga. Embrace your inner sexiness while firming, toning and strengthening key areas with these daring moves. Even beginner class attendees leave having successfully pulled off three or more aerial poses. Silks are provided and safety is guaranteed so be brave, pick your feet up off the ground and move at Vertical Fitness. Two-for-one deals and more are available now on the Vertical Fitness website.

Smart Barre-Fort Worth
3515 Bluebonnet Circle
Fort Worth, TX 76109
(817) 924-0775
smartbarrebody.comNothing like the stiff ballet classes of the past, Smart Barre is a healthy mixture of ballet techniques, yoga and targeted fitness, blended together in a way that works the areas that give women the most grief. A traditional barre as well as other contemporary equipment is used to keep the class upbeat and exciting. Combining fun, strength, stretching and sculpting, Smart Barre will prove to be a long-standing option in the fitness world.
